Summary
Amidst the violent weather of Europe's Little Ice Age, 'A Slender Tether' offers a novel in linked stories on self-discovery, woven into a rich tapestry of 14th century France. Christine de Pizan, now heralded as Europe's first feminist and brilliant author, grapples with ambition and alienation amid the beautiful women at court. A doctor finds an unusual way to cope with the death of his wife. And opportunity alternates with disasters in the lives of four commoners who are yoked by necessity: a papermaker struggling to keep his business, a falconer with a mysterious past, a merchant's daughter frantic to avoid an arranged marriage, and a down-on-his-luck musician with a broken guitar and the voice of an angel.
